Business. Mehran Sugar Mills Ltd is a food processing company that produces and sells sugar, generating revenue primarily through the sale of refined sugar and related by-products.

Classification. Mehran Sugar Mills Ltd is classified under the Consumer Non-Cyclicals economic sector, Food & Beverages business sector, and Food Processing industry, with a confidence level of 0.92.

Mehran Sugar Mills Ltd has a debt-to-equity ratio of 2.32, indicating a capital structure that is heavily leveraged, with long-term debt accounting for a significant portion of its liabilities. The company's liquidity position is assessed as medium, with a current ratio of 1.11, suggesting it has just enough current assets to cover its current liabilities. However, the company's operating cash flow is negative at -880,624,435 PKR, which raises concerns about its ability to fund operations and debt obligations from operating activities. In terms of profitability, the company's return on equity (ROE) is 5.49%, which is relatively low, and its return on assets (ROA) is 1.46%, indicating that the company is not efficiently utilizing its assets to generate returns. These metrics are below the typical thresholds for strong performance in the food processing industry, suggesting that the company may be underperforming relative to its peers. The company's revenue is concentrated in a single business segment, as disclosed in its financial statements, with no material diversification across product lines or geographic regions. This lack of diversification increases the company's exposure to market-specific risks, such as fluctuations in sugar prices or demand in its primary markets. The company's growth trajectory appears to be constrained, with no significant revenue growth reported in the latest financial period. The capital expenditure of -58,865,880 PKR suggests that the company is not investing heavily in new projects or infrastructure, which could limit its ability to expand or modernize its operations. The company's risk profile includes a medium liquidity risk, primarily due to its negative operating cash flow and high debt levels. The risk of dilution is assessed as low, with no significant changes in shares outstanding between basic and diluted shares. However, the company's net cash position is negative after subtracting total debt, which could necessitate future financing activities that may involve equity dilution. Recent filings and transcripts do not indicate any major strategic shifts or significant events that would impact the company's operations or financial performance in the near term. The company appears to be maintaining a stable but conservative approach to its business strategy.
